Inspection and Audit Rights Sample Clauses

Inspection and Audit Rights. The Master Servicer agrees that, on reasonable prior notice, it will permit and will cause each Subservicer to permit any representative of the Depositor or the Trustee during the Master Servicer's normal business hours, to examine all the books of account, records, reports and other papers of the Master Servicer relating to the Mortgage Loans, to make copies and extracts therefrom, to cause such books to be audited by independent certified public accountants selected by the Depositor or the Trustee and to discuss its affairs, finances and accounts relating to the Mortgage Loans with its officers, employees and independent public accountants (and by this provision the Master Servicer hereby authorizes said accountants to discuss with such representative such affairs, finances and accounts), all at such reasonable times and as often as may be reasonably requested. Any out-of-pocket expense incident to the exercise by the Depositor or the Trustee of any right under this Section 10.09 shall be borne by the party requesting such inspection; all other such expenses shall be borne by the Master Servicer or the related Subservicer.

Inspection and Audit Rights. Each Servicer agrees that on reasonable prior notice, it will permit any representative of the Depositor, the Master Servicer or the Trustee during such Servicer's normal business hours, to examine all the books of account, records, reports and other papers of such Servicer relating to the applicable Mortgage Loans, to make copies and extracts therefrom, to cause such books to be audited by independent certified public accountants selected by the Depositor, the Master Servicer or the Trustee and to discuss its affairs, finances and accounts relating to such Mortgage Loans with its officers, employees and independent public accountants (and by this provision each Servicer hereby authorizes said accountants to discuss with such representative such affairs, finances and accounts), all at such reasonable times and as often as may be reasonably requested. Any reasonable out-of-pocket expense of a Servicer incident to the exercise by the Depositor, the Master Servicer or the Trustee of any right under this Section 12.09 shall be borne by the party making the request (except in the case of requests made by the Trustee, such expenses shall be borne by such Servicer). Each Servicer may impose commercially reasonable restrictions on dissemination of information such Servicer defines as confidential. Nothing in this Section 12.09 shall limit the obligation of each Servicer to observe any applicable law prohibiting disclosure of information regarding the Mortgagors and the failure of such Servicer to provide access as provided in this Section 12.09 as a result of such obligation shall not constitute a breach of this Section. Nothing in this Section 12.09 shall require each Servicer to collect, create, collate or otherwise generate any information that it does not generate in its usual course of business. Each Servicer shall not be required to make copies of or to ship documents to any Person who is not a party to this Agreement, and then only if provisions have been made for the reimbursement of the costs thereof.
